Abstract

The challenge of intolerance has surfaced as a significant concern for the Muslim Ummah, leading to various social and ideological issues. Islam actively discourages intolerance, advocating for patience, forbearance, and mutual respect. The teachings of Islam promote tolerance while denouncing extremism, radicalism, and inflexibility in all its forms. Although Islam permits intellectual and ideological differences, it firmly prohibits hostility, hatred, and conflict arising from such differences. At its core, true tolerance means that individuals can live together harmoniously, regardless of their beliefs, race, color, language, or nationality, without succumbing to prejudice or discrimination. It emphasizes the importance of respecting others' rights and avoiding animosity towards those of different faiths and ideologies, even if one does not agree with their beliefs. Tolerance is a refined hallmark of civilization and a noble facet of human culture — a divine gift to humanity. A closer look at Islamic teachings shows that Islam not only advocates for tolerance but also serves as its leading champion. The Qur’an clearly states: “There is no compulsion in religion; truth stands out clear from error.”(Al-Baqarah 2:256) Likewise, the Seerah (biography) of the Prophet Muhammad showcases remarkable examples of tolerance and compassion towards non-Muslims and adversaries. The Rightly Guided Caliphs (Khulafā’ al-Rāshidīn) also embodied these principles, setting shining examples of tolerance that have been etched in history. This research paper offers a thorough analytical exploration of tolerance through the lens of the Seerah of the Prophet Muhammad and historical contexts, highlighting Islam’s universal message of peace, coexistence, and mutual respect.
